    I'm using Nero Recode 2.4.5.0. I'm trying to encode a movie that has a Dolby 5.1 soundtrack to Nero Digital 5.1 audio. On the main screen, when I choose Dolby Digital 5.1 from the original movie, I only get for "Encode Nero Digital Audio" the "Stereo" option. The "5.1 channel surround" option is grayed out. When I click on Settings, under Audio Channels the only choice available is Stereo. I tried all the Nero Digital categories and profiles, but nothing works. I did a clean install of Nero, nothing changed. Any ideas?
